Output 63d6a95c9445cc1190e6db4a3f64683486e36974f9d44f12ebb783e23f765ecd:0

value
25033868
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7220c4916dd94c621970990bd73ba6736b123ab2 OP_EQUAL
address
3C6UDAMhUtzG8ZkaL33ArJ4xxsn1tp75Xy
transaction
63d6a95c9445cc1190e6db4a3f64683486e36974f9d44f12ebb783e23f765ecd
spent
true